%0 Journal Article %T Papillary carcinoma in a recurrent thyroglossal duct cyst %A Arif Viqar %A Shah Naveed %A Shahnawaz Bashir %A Syed Ruzina Firdose %A Syed Sahila Firdose %A Tanveer Hassan Banday %J Bangladesh Journal of Medical Science %D 2017 %R https://doi.org/10.3329/bjms.v16i1.31154 %X Thyroglossal duct carcinoma (TGDC) is a rare disease with many reported cases. The recurrence in such cases after surgical removal may be seen after cyst excision. Sistrunks operation is recommended, as it has a very low recurrence rate. The case which present as recurrence demonstrate histological pattern similar to a thyroglossal duct cyst. We present a case of recurrence of thyroglossal cyst, with a solid internal component on ultrasonography (USG). On histopathology the solid internal component proved to be papillary carcinoma. To our knowledge, our paper is the first case of recurrent thyroglossal cyst with a papillary carcinoma preoperatively suspected on USG Bangladesh Journal of Medical Science Vol.16(1) 2017 p.166-169 %K Thyroglossal duct carcinoma %K Papillary carcinoma thyroid (PTC) %K Ultrasound (USG) %U https://www.banglajol.info/index.php/BJMS/article/view/31154
